Raskob and Kaufman of the Kaufman Organization lease 7,200 s/f

The Kaufman Org. has signed a five-year, 7,200 s/f lease at 462 Seventh Ave. for Emerging Media Group, Inc. "The Emerging Media Group helps to build the brands of pharmaceutical and financial service companies as well as consumer products," said Barbara Raskob of the Kaufman Org. "Their business has grown, and we were able to provide them with the office space they needed to accommodate that growth." Steven Kaufman and Raskob of the Kaufman Org. represented the landlord, while Paul Walker of CBRE represented the tenant. 462 Seventh Ave., built in 1925, is a 23-story building in the Garment District. The 185,000 s/f structure features 24/7 access and a shared entrance with 470 Seventh Ave. Tenants include Geller & Wind Ltd., Winoker Realty, and InnerWorkings, Inc.
